How Does the Algorithm Impact AI?

As someone who works in social media, algorithms and I are already very well acquainted. I’ve spent years trying to understand what they want, adapting to their changes and occasionally wondering what I’ve done to personally offend them.

But understanding algorithms through the lens of AI opened up a much bigger conversation about what’s actually happening behind the technology we use every day.

What I learned is that algorithms are fundamental to AI. They help systems process information, spot patterns and use those patterns to make predictions or produce outputs. Basically, if I wanted to understand what was going on under AI’s bonnet, I needed to get better acquainted with algorithms outside of Instagram.

Man vs Machine? Man ❤️’s Machine

My final Learning Journey for this month was Working With The Machine, and this one felt particularly relevant to how I actually use AI day-to-day.

The lesson does a great job of explaining the new habits we need to adopt, how our work is changing now we’ve essentially got a paperclip assistant on super serum at our side at all times, and how we actually need to talk to AI if we want to get the most out of it.

Because now we all have a little genius sitting in the palm of our hand, but if the only instruction we give it is “write a caption about my event”, we can’t exactly be outraged when it comes back with:

“🚨✨ BIG NEWS! ✨🚨 We’re SO excited to announce our AMAZING upcoming event! 🎉🙌 Get ready for an unforgettable experience packed with inspiration 💡, connection 🤝 and incredible opportunities 🚀! You WON’T want to miss this! 💯✨🎊🚀🚀🚀”

Here’s what we need to remember: AI hasn’t done a bad job here. We gave it nothing.

No personality, no context, no creativity. None of the experiences, opinions, humour, instincts or weird little connections that make our work unmistakably ours.

AI can take some of the generic stuff off our plates, and that leaves us with more time for the special bit.

The human bit.

Our creativity, our judgement, our empathy. Our ability to read a room, make someone laugh, tell a story, understand what someone really means.

AI doesn’t have to dilute those things. Used well, it can put a microscope on them. Less time doing the generic stuff, more time doing the things that make our work ours.

And that’s probably my biggest takeaway from this month’s Learning Journey. Maybe we’ve been thinking about Man vs Machine all wrong. 

Understanding the machine doesn’t make the human less important.

Quite the opposite – it might just give us more time to be human.
